首页
学习
活动
专区
圈层
工具
发布

开发Garmin佳明手表应用准备工作

研究了那么久,还是做不了自己的表盘 前段时间在淘宝上买了一个佳明表Instinct 颜值高,功能齐全,可扩展. 用了一段时间,突然想,这么高级的一款产品,能不能支持开发者自己开发应用?...the Help menu Choose Install New Software… Click the Add… button Add https://developer.garmin.com/downloads.../connect-iq/eclipse/ to the Location field and click OK Check the box next to Connect IQ in the Available...In Eclipse, click the Connect IQ menu Choose Open SDK Manager Click the Download button next to the...下载完SDK后,解压后可以看到 在开始开发之前,可以将SDK根目录的三个html看完,可以避免很多坑, 表盘的坐标系 在layout.xml中使用x,y和justification来控制元素在表盘的位置

1.7K21

利用 Github Actions 同步佳明国区数据到国际区

账号设置 如果你正在使用佳明手表,那么肯定已经有了国内区的账号了,如果是将要使用,可以在这个地址进行注册: https://connect.garmin.cn/signin/ 佳明国际区 佳明国际区的的账号注册地址是...:https://connect.garmin.com/signin/ ,需要注意的是国际区注册时选择区域需要选择美国。...正常情况下,Fork 项目没有问题,但我实际验证时发现 Github 上的代码貌似不是最新的,作者把最新的代码放在 Gitlab 上,所以建议在 Gitlab 上下载代码,然后上传到自己个 Github...Sync Garmin CN to Garmin Global:从国区到国际区的同步,新数据同步可以使用这个 6、当我们点击进入「Migrate Garmin CN to Garmin Global」...Workflow ,可以选择「禁用」: 12、上面介绍了手动迁移的 Workflow,自动同步用的是:Sync Garmin CN to Garmin Global ,默认是开启的,每 6 个小时同步一次

1.5K10
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Fluwx:微信SDK在Flutter上的实现

    前言 随着 Flutter越来越火热,我相信越来越多的小伙伴都跃跃欲试。但是一个很重要的问题是,很多第三方 SDK,如微信SDK,都无法在Flutter上直接使用。...所以,我这几天开发了一个微信SDK的插件,希望能够一定程度上帮助到大家。 Fluwx要做什么 分享 登录 支付 这是Fluwx的目标。...如果你想也成为Fluwx的开发者,可以给我留言。 需要准备的 使用Fluwx之前,强烈建议先阅读微信SDK官方文档, 这有助于你使用Fluwx。...Fluwx的api字段名称基本和官方的字段名称是一致的。...注册完成后,请在对应平台添加如下代码: 在Android上:FluwxShareHandler.setWXApi(wxapi) 在iOS上:isWeChatRegistered = YES;你也可以取消注册你的

    1.9K30

    Fluwx:微信SDK在Flutter上的实现

    前言 随着 Flutter越来越火热,我相信越来越多的小伙伴都跃跃欲试。但是一个很重要的问题是,很多第三方 SDK,如微信SDK,都无法在Flutter上直接使用。...所以,我这几天开发了一个微信SDK的插件,希望能够一定程度上帮助到大家。 Fluwx要做什么 分享 登录 支付 这是Fluwx的目标。...如果你想也成为Fluwx的开发者,可以给我留言。 需要准备的 使用Fluwx之前,强烈建议先阅读微信SDK官方文档, 这有助于你使用Fluwx。...Fluwx的api字段名称基本和官方的字段名称是一致的。...注册完成后,请在对应平台添加如下代码: 在Android上: FluwxShareHandler.setWXApi(wxapi) 在iOS上: isWeChatRegistered = YES; 你也可以取消注册你的

    2.3K20

    大疆(Dji)SDK思路前的准备(上)

    虽然对于这个SDK的使用其实已经是高级的操作了,但是考虑到一些原因还是写一句SDK在应用中的地位 ?...一张很好的图~ Mobile SDK 几乎全线支持大疆的硬件产品,在开发平台上支持现在主流的两大移动端系统平台:iOS 和 Android,换句话说,通过 Mobile SDK 最后开发出来的就是我们常见的手机...,大疆的机载电脑(如妙算)和 Onboard SDK 就是很好的选择了。...Guidance SDK,顾名思义,就是为 Guidance 导航系统而设的 SDK,通过 SDK 你可以从 Guidance 硬件上获取到各种输出数据,包括实时三维速度、IMU 数据,五向超声波距离等等...最普遍的移动端SDK https://enterprise.dji.com/cn/sdk ? 一些基于Dji SDK开发的软件 ?

    3.2K20

    DebianKali Linux KDE Connect 无法检测网络上的任何设备 无法工作

    记录一下最近在Debian 12 测试版(testing)及Kali Linux 2023.3遇到的KDE Connect 无使用问题,具体表现为KDE Connect 无法检测网络上的任何设备,无法工作...起初是在Kali Linux 2023.3上遇到的,通过以下两种方式可是解决: 1/nohup /usr/lib/x86_64-linux-gnu/libexec/kdeconnectd &>/dev/...null & 或 mv /usr/share/dbus-1/services/org.kde.kdeconnect.service{.original,} 后来在Debian 12及Debian测试版上也出现了同样的问题...,而Debian的解决方案为更改防火墙设置,两个问题的原因应该不是一样的,因为在Kali Linux下不显示本地计算机名,而Debian下可以显示本地计算机名。...参考: [1] KDE connect doesn’t detect any devices on network - Debian User Forums [2] 0008204: KDEConnect

    2.9K10

    问脉 SDK: 云原生安全的最强外挂 (上)

    然而,上云除了带来技术红利的同时,也带来了相当多的安全问题,比如对于  ak/sk  (accesskey/accesssecret) 的泄露这样一个简简单单的问题,就让很多甲方头痛,头痛的点不在于检测本身...还是  openshift  ),基于这套 SDK,开发者只需要关心核心的检测逻辑,而不需要担心任何的兼容和适配性问题。...这个想法一出来,就和公司的小伙伴们一拍即合,决定立刻开始做,这就是问脉 SDK 的由来。...我们面临的第一个问题是,如何统一容器运行时? 熟悉云原生的人应该知道,所有的容器,实际上都是被容器运行时,比如  docker/containerd/cri-o/podman  等拉起来的。...SDK 就不是一个好 SDK。

    43920

    世界上最好用的 Alipay 和 WeChat 的支付 SDK

    今天介绍一个关于 PHP 支付方面的扩展,现阶段支持 Alipay 和 WeChat ,可能以后会支持更多种网关 用作者的话说:可能是我用过的最优雅的 Alipay 和 WeChat 的支付 SDK...daily 时有效,默认 30 天 ], 'http' => [ // optional 'timeout' => 5.0, 'connect_timeout...// 1、商户需要验证该通知数据中的out_trade_no是否为商户系统中创建的订单号; // 2、判断total_amount是否确实为该订单的实际金额(即商户订单创建时的金额...daily 时有效,默认 30 天 ], 'http' => [ // optional 'timeout' => 5.0, 'connect_timeout...你要做的无非就是把你的 配置信息单独取出来,比如铭感信息 appid、秘钥等信息,不要暴露出来就好。

    1.7K20

    用 Loom SDK 搭建的以太坊侧链上运行 DApp

    上一篇,我们在Loom 构建的DApp侧链上部署了智能合约[1],这篇文章就来基于侧链网络部署一个DApp(去中心化应用)。...this.client, this.privateKey)) // ❶ }} ❶ 为初始化web3 代码, 构造 LoomProvider 对象时需要传入 client 对象和一个私钥,在侧链上发起的交易...networkId, writeUrl, readUrl) this.client.on('error', msg => { console.error('Error on connect...,和我们在 上一篇loom 上部署合约[5]中 truffle.js 的配置相似,都是指定节点的 RPC 信息,可以参考loom 官方文档[6]。...注: 如果提示 webpack-dev-server命令找不到,可以使用npm install webpack-dev-server -g 全局安装 Loom 目前的缺陷 在侧链上运行的DApp 交互响应时间好很多

    1.1K20

    怎么让APP`iTunes Connect`名字和在设备上显示的名字是一致的

    怎么让APPiTunes Connect名字和在设备上显示的名字是一致的。 在iTunes Connect和设备上显示的名字是一致的,因为避免混淆。...对于WatchKit的app,对于WatchKit应用程序,这意味着在iTunes Connect应用程序名称应该是类似于iPhone主屏幕,在AppWatch和iPhone上面的APP watch 应用...项,设置为匹配您在iTunes Connect使用的应用程序名称的值。...为iOS应用指定包的显示名称的详细步骤将在QA1823(更新您的应用程序的显示名称),对于WatchKit应用程序,包显示名称为默认设置为它的容器应用程序的产品名称。...如果您的应用支持多种本地化,一定要本地化的软件包的名称和捆绑iOS应用的显示名称,您WatchKit应用的软件包显示名称,将它们添加到您的所有特定语言的InfoPlist.strings文件。

    1.6K30

    直播SDK在低端安卓设备上的流畅运行技术指南

    摘要 本文旨在探讨直播SDK在低端安卓设备上实现流畅运行的技术解析、操作指南和增强方案。通过分析直播SDK的核心价值、挑战和实施步骤,结合腾讯云产品的集成优势,提供一套完整的技术解决方案。...技术解析 核心价值与典型场景 直播SDK为开发者提供了快速集成直播功能的能力,使得应用能够轻松实现音视频直播功能。在教育、娱乐、游戏等场景中,直播SDK能够提供实时互动体验,增强用户粘性。...电量消耗:直播过程中的高功耗可能导致低端设备的电池快速耗尽。 操作指南 实施流程 环境准备:确保安卓设备满足直播SDK的最低系统要求。...,在低端安卓设备上实现了流畅的直播教学,根据客户反馈,直播卡顿率降低了50%。...通过上述技术指南,开发者可以有效地在低端安卓设备上实现直播SDK的流畅运行,同时利用腾讯云产品的优势,提升直播体验和降低成本。

    23110

    用微信来搞世界上最好的语言——消息收发SDK的实现

    在上一章中实现了一文本消息的互动。本章将在上一篇基础上完成开发。 微信的基础消息接口包括三个部分:接收普通消息、发送被动回复消息、接收事件消息。 4.1 文本消息 4.10 写基础消息的SDK 【需求】根据之前的消息范例,写一个微信公众号的SDK。...4.10.1 消息流程 基础消息的SDK将前面章节的各种接收消息类型进行了处理,另外对被动发送消息类型进行了定义。...由之前的原理可得: 用户发出消息=>校验=>判断消息类型,跳转不同业务逻辑=>根据不同消息类型,制定不同的消息。 和上一章一样,定义一个 wechatCallbackapiTest类: <?...php /** * 微信第一个SDK */ header('Content-type:text'); define('TOKEN','weixin'); $wechatObj=new wechatCallbackapiTest

    1.1K20

    你戴佳明手表吗?服务器遭黑客攻击,全球跑友无法同步跑步数据!

    大数据产业创新服务媒体 ——聚焦数据 · 改变商业 ---- 数据猿消息,据美国媒体《福布斯》、美联社等媒体报道,佳明(Garmin)的国际服务器受到了黑客攻击,目前正处于瘫痪状态,除中国服务区外,全球其他地区的佳明用户现在都无法同步自己的运动和健康数据...这款软件由Evil Corp运营,该团队是总部位于俄罗斯的网络犯罪组织。报道称,佳明被要求支付1000万美元赎金,否则就会删除服务器上的所有数据。...其实,从7月23日下午开始,佳明国际用户就发现无法将智能手表的数据同步至手机端,佳明美国账号当晚就在社交媒体上发布消息称,佳明服务器已宕机,Garmin Connect APP因此也受到了影响,并且佳明的通讯系统也瘫痪了...实际上,佳明在中国的服务器,这次并没有受到攻击,中国的佳明用户只要注册时选择的是中国服务器,手表就可以正常使用,数据也可以正常同步。...但据一位来自英国的跑友称,他花了800英镑买入的Fenix 6,上次跑完步后保存数据,界面一直就卡在了Saving上,时间也看不了,关机也关不上。

    1.5K10

    实现低端安卓设备上的流畅美颜特效SDK集成技术指南

    摘要 本文旨在解析美颜特效SDK在低端安卓设备上的流畅运行技术能力,并提供详细的操作指南。我们将探讨技术核心价值、实施挑战,并通过集成腾讯云产品TUIRoomKit来实现性能优化和高可用设计。...最后,通过对比表格和场景化案例展示腾讯云方案的优势。 技术解析 核心价值与典型场景 美颜特效SDK的核心价值在于提升用户体验,特别是在视频会议和社交媒体应用中。...兼容性问题:不同品牌和型号的安卓设备可能存在兼容性差异,影响美颜效果的一致性。 网络延迟:不稳定的网络连接可能导致美颜模型文件下载延迟,影响用户体验。...这一特性有助于在低端设备上实现流畅的美颜特效。 步骤4:高可用设计 利用腾讯云TKE的容器部署能力,提升容器部署效率。据IDC 2024报告,采用腾讯云TKE后容器部署效率提升300%。...结论 通过本文的技术指南,您可以了解到如何在低端安卓设备上实现流畅的美颜特效SDK集成。通过腾讯云产品的特性,我们不仅解决了性能和兼容性的挑战,还提升了用户体验和应用效率。

    17410

    一次勒索病毒攻击,让1500万用户“停跑”

    7月23号晚上,越来越多Garmin(佳明)智能手表的用户突然发现,自己的智能手表无法与手机上的配套APP“Garmin Connect”同步,APP本身也无法更新数据,就连之前的一些运动轨迹也无法查看...勒索病毒1.png 很多用户迫不得已,只能跑到各种各样的社交平台网站上去叙述自己的遭遇顺带着投诉。Garmin官方在社交平台上迅速回应:“官方正努力修复问题,就事件造成的不便致歉。”...坊间还传闻,对方直接向佳明开出了1000万美元的赎金,威胁要删除服务器上的所有数据。...Garmin遭受攻击将影响至少1500万用户。...事实上,越来越多的企业在智能产品的打造上,正在参考佳明的路线——在多个应用端、平台上共通数据,用云端和大数据的优势全面提升自家产品和服务的体验。

    57531

    技术指南:短视频SDK在低端安卓设备上的流畅运行方案

    摘要 本文旨在解析短视频SDK在低端安卓设备上的运行挑战,并提供详细的操作指南以及增强方案,以确保短视频应用能在性能受限的设备上实现流畅播放。...通过结合腾讯云点播服务,本文将展示如何优化短视频SDK的性能,并提供实际案例以证明方案的有效性。...内存管理:优化短视频SDK的内存使用,避免内存溢出。 电池优化:通过腾讯云点播的高效视频编码技术,减少电池消耗。 步骤五:测试与部署 设备测试:在多种低端安卓设备上测试短视频SDK的性能。...在短视频应用领域,腾讯云点播服务帮助某电商客户在低端设备上实现了视频播放的流畅性提升,用户满意度提高了40%。...结语 通过上述指南,我们可以看到,即使在低端安卓设备上,通过合理的技术选型和腾讯云产品的深度集成,短视频SDK也能实现流畅的运行效果。这不仅提升了用户体验,也为开发者提供了更多的便利。

    23010

    如何在Fedora 35上通过配置WireGuard VPN,确保跨境远程办公环境的安全性与高效连接?

    在全球化办公越来越普及的今天,跨境远程办公对网络安全、连接稳定性和传输效率的要求极高。...一、方案概览与目标本文目标是在一台运行Fedora35(LinuxKernel5.14+)的服务器上配置WireGuardVPN,并让跨境远程办公客户端(Windows、macOS、Linux、iOS/...三、系统准备:Fedora35基本配置3.1安装系统与更新假设服务器已装Fedora35,使用root执行:展开代码语言:BashAI代码解释dnfupdate-ydnfinstall-ykernel‑headerskernel‑devel...51820PrivateKey=#推送DNS给客户端DNS=1.1.1.1#可选:持久保存状态SaveConfig=true#NAT/路由规则由firewall/cmd管理替换为上一节生成的内容...如需进一步扩展到容器化、自动化部署(Ansible、Terraform)、或与身份认证(LDAP/Radius)集成,可在此基础上继续深化。

    9110

    PhoneSploit-Pro:一款针对Android设备的多合一远程渗透测试工具

    该工具支持在目标设备上使用Metasploit-Framework和ADB自动化创建、安装和运行Payload,并一键完成针对目标Android设备的渗透测试。...工具要求 Python3:Python 3.10或更新版本; ADB:Android调试桥,可从Android SDK Platform Tools获取; Metasploit-Framework...: Ubuntu Linux Mint Kali Linux Fedora Arch Linux Parrot Security OS Windows 11 Termux (...Android) 工具下载 由于该工具基于Python 3.10开发,因此我们首先需要在本地设备上安装并配置好Python 3.10环境。...和adb tcpip 5555命令对手机进行初始化状态设置; Android手机非首次连接设置 1、将手机与主机电脑连接到同一个WiFi网络中; 2、运行PhoneSploit-Pro并选择“Connect

    1.1K20
    领券